> liburcu is a LGPLv2.1 userspace RCU (read-copy-update) library. This
> data synchronization library provides read-side access which scales
> linearly with the number of cores. It does so by allowing multiple
> copies of a given data structure to live at the same time, and by
> monitoring the data structure accesses to detect grace periods after
> which memory reclamation is possible.
>
> liburcu-cds provides efficient data structures based on RCU and
> lock-free algorithms. Those structures include hash tables, queues,
> stacks, and doubly-linked lists.

I had to do a quick 0.9.1 release to add missing test files to
the makefile so they would be included in the distribution
tarballs. This ensures make regtest, make short_bench and
make long_bench all work fine when run on a tree extracted
from a distribution tarball.

> New and Noteworthy
>
> Two years after the 0.8.0 release, it's about time we release
> Userspace RCU 0.9.0 with some interesting new features:
>
> * liburcu.so and liburcu-bp.so now use the membarrier system call
> to speed up RCU read-side critical sections when available. It
> is newly introduced in Linux 4.3. See kernel/membarrier.c in a
> recent Linux kernel tree for details.
> * Port Userspace RCU to Android,
> * Port Userspace RCU to Solaris 10 and 11,
> * Refactoring of tests into the following make targets:
> # Short sanity check
> make check
> # Few minutes regression testing
> make regtest
> # Few tens of minutes benchmarks
> make short_bench
> # Hours-long benchmarks
> make long_bench
> * Tests now output in "tap", for easier integration in continuous
> integration. See https://ci.lttng.org/job/liburcu/ for the
> Userspace RCU CI job.
> - Port to aarch64 and powerpc64le architectures,
> - Port to hppa/PA-RISC architecture,
>
> Note: the soname major has been bumped to 4 even though it really
> only needed to be bumped to 3.
